More about the book
Set against the backdrop of 1950, the story unfolds with Ariah Erskine, who becomes known as "the Widow Bride of the Falls" after her husband’s tragic suicide. As she waits for his body, she forms an unexpected bond with Dirk Burnaby, a confirmed bachelor. Their passionate love affair leads to marriage and a growing family, yet the shadows of their past haunt them, introducing elements of distrust, greed, and murder that threaten their seemingly perfect life.
